Aaron Lansky, who rescued 1.5 million Yiddish books and founded the Yiddish Book Center, is retiring
Aaron Lansky, founder of the Yiddish Book Center, is retiring after rescuing 1.5 million Yiddish books and helping revitalize Yiddish language, literature, and culture.
